#3e764b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e764b is composed of 24.3% red, 46.3%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 133.9 degrees, a saturation of 31.1% and a lightness of 35.3%. #3e764b color hex could be obtained by blending #7cec96 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#3e764b color description : Dark moderate lime green.

#3e764b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3e764b has RGB values of R:62, G:118,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 4093515.

Shades and Tints of #3e764b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4f9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e764b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5a5a is the less saturated color, while #07ad2d is the most saturated one.
